My Thoughts


L. K. Farlow delivers an emotionally charged and deeply moving standalone novel in His to Save, the captivating first installment of the Lake Fortune series. This isn't your typical lighthearted romance; it's a raw, poignant journey that meticulously peels back layers of trauma to reveal the enduring power of hope and healing. Farlow doesn't shy away from the darkness, beginning with a chilling premise: a Npra's innocence stolen, her life isolated and tormented by the very man who should have protected her. The chilling detail of her diary as a sole companion paints a stark picture of her years of suffering, immediately drawing the reader into her desperate plight.

The story truly ignites when two pink lines force Nora to confront her terrifying reality and seek escape. Her vulnerability is palpable, making her eventual flight both harrowing and heroic. It's at this crucial juncture that Atlas, the son of her tormentor, enters the scene, offering an unexpected lifeline. Farlow masterfully builds the dynamic between them, cultivating a slow-burn romance steeped in mutual trust and genuine connection. Atlas is the epitome of the protective hero, utterly devoted to safeguarding her and her unborn child. His unwavering resolve to prove he's nothing like his father is a central, compelling theme, providing a beacon of light in her shattered world.

His to Save excels in its exploration of heavy themes—isolation, abuse, and the arduous path to recovery—yet it never feels overwhelming. Instead, it’s a testament to the resilience of the human spirit and the transformative power of love. The small-town suspense elements keep the tension simmering, always reminding you of the lurking danger, while the age gap adds another layer of intriguing complexity to their burgeoning relationship. Farlow’s writing is evocative, stitching together fragments of fear and flickers of tenderness into a cohesive narrative. The journey towards healing is neither rushed nor simplistic, making the eventual outcome incredibly satisfying and hard-won. If you're seeking a romance that delves deep, challenges emotions, and celebrates profound healing, His to Save is a powerful read that will resonate long after the final page.
